  • What are the must-see attractions in County Down, United Kingdom?

    County Down boasts many stunning attractions. For history buffs, there's the iconic Castle Ward, a filming location for Game of Thrones, and the impressive Mount Stewart, a National Trust property with beautiful gardens. Nature lovers should head to the Mourne Mountains, offering breathtaking hikes and panoramic views, or explore the picturesque Strangford Lough, an area of outstanding natural beauty with abundant wildlife. Don't miss the charming seaside town of Newcastle, with its sandy beaches and vibrant atmosphere.

  • What are the most characteristic landscapes and terrains found in County Down, United Kingdom?

    County Down's landscape is incredibly diverse. The dramatic Mourne Mountains dominate the south, offering rugged peaks and valleys. In contrast, the Strangford Lough area presents a gentler landscape of rolling hills, coastline, and the vast expanse of the lough itself. The Ards Peninsula provides a mix of farmland and coastal scenery. Each area offers unique beauty and character.

  • What are the best outdoor activities in County Down, United Kingdom?

    Outdoor enthusiasts will find plenty to do in County Down. Hiking in the Mourne Mountains is a must, with trails catering to various skill levels. Kayaking or boat trips on Strangford Lough allow you to explore the coastline and abundant wildlife. Cycling routes traverse the countryside, and many beaches offer opportunities for swimming, surfing, or simply relaxing by the sea. The Royal County Down Golf Club is also a world-renowned course.

  • What are some lesser-known attractions or hidden gems in County Down, United Kingdom?

    While many attractions are well-known, County Down holds several hidden gems. The Tollymore Forest Park, with its ancient woodland and river walks, is a tranquil escape. Exploring the smaller coastal villages along the Ards Peninsula can uncover charming harbours and scenic viewpoints. Delving into the history of smaller towns like Ardglass or Killyleagh can reveal fascinating stories and architecture.
  • What are some must-try local dishes in County Down, United Kingdom?

    County Down offers some delicious local dishes. Seafood is a staple, with fresh oysters and mussels readily available. Traditional Irish stew is a hearty option, and many pubs and restaurants offer locally sourced meats and produce. Ulster Fry is a very popular breakfast option.
